The Versatility of Korean Fine Red Pepper Powder


Korean fine red pepper powder, commonly known as gochugaru, is a staple in Korean cuisine and has recently gained popularity worldwide for its vibrant color and unique flavor profile. Characterized by its vibrant red hue and a slightly coarse texture, gochugaru is made from sun-dried chili peppers that are ground to a fine powder. This spice is not just an ingredient; it's a hallmark of Korean culinary traditions that brings depth and richness to various dishes.


One of the most remarkable features of gochugaru is its diverse flavor. Unlike regular chili powders, which are often purely spicy, gochugaru offers a complex taste that balances smokiness, sweetness, and heat. This combination makes it ideal for recipes ranging from the famed kimchi to stews, sauces, and marinades. Kimchi, a fermented vegetable dish, relies heavily on gochugaru for its signature flavor and color, making it an essential ingredient for anyone seeking to replicate authentic Korean dishes.

The health benefits associated with gochugaru add another layer of appeal. It is rich in vitamins A and C, which contribute to immune health and skin vitality. Additionally, the capsaicin present in chili peppers is known to boost metabolism and promote weight loss. The anti-inflammatory properties of certain compounds in gochugaru may also help in reducing the risk of chronic diseases, making it not only a flavorful addition but a nutritious one as well.

Moreover, gochugaru's adaptability transcends traditional Korean recipes. Chefs and home cooks alike have begun to experiment with this spice in global cuisine. Adding a dash of gochugaru to tacos, pasta sauces, or even Asian-inspired salad dressings introduces an exciting twist that surprises the palate. This adaptability speaks to its potential for fusion cooking, allowing it to bridge culinary traditions by integrating seamlessly into various dishes.


For those interested in cooking with gochugaru, finding the right quality is essential. Premium gochugaru has a deep red color and a fragrant aroma, which indicates freshness and high-quality peppers. It’s best to store gochugaru in an airtight container away from light and moisture to maintain its potency. When purchasing, be sure to check for authenticity, as the market is filled with various chili powders that may not provide the same flavor experience.
